- A Rightful Heir’s Return: After years in exile, Nalia must battle her way back to Arjinna to dethrone the tyrant Calar. But claiming her crown will cost more than she can imagine.- A Revolution Divided: Raif has the soldiers to win the war, but his love for Nalia threatens to splinter the resistance from within.- Gods and Goddesses at Play: The fate of Arjinna doesn’t just rest in mortal hands. Ancient deities have their own plans for the realm, and they aren’t afraid to interfere.- Treason in the Tyrant’s Court: The empress Calar believes she holds all the power, but a conspiracy is unfolding from the one person she trusts most, threatening to topple her reign from the inside.- An Epic Conclusion: The heart-pounding final book in the Dark Caravan Cycle, where love and loyalty are tested and the fate of a kingdom hangs in the balance.
